Cell Biology and Organelles Flashcard Deck - 10 Cards
Flashcard 1: The lumen of the rough endoplasmic reticulum is continuous with _____ space.
Answer: perinuclear
Flashcard 2: Keratin filaments present in Stratum basale layer are _____
Answer: K5/K14.
Flashcard 3: The cytoplasm and nucleus together are referred to as _____.
Answer: protoplasm
Flashcard 4: _____ are commonly observed in perinuclear areas in cardiac muscle
Answer: Lysosomes (Cell organelle)
Flashcard 5: _____ is located in supranuclear cytoplasm in serous acinar cells
Answer: Golgi complex (Cell organelle)
Flashcard 6: A _____ chromosome is an aberrant chromosome whose ends have fused together, often formed due to break at both ends of the chromosome.
Answer: ring
Flashcard 7: _____ refers to the fluid-filled spaces enclosed within the membrane-bound cell organelles.
Answer: Vacuoplasm
Flashcard 8: Secretory cells also known as _____ are maximally located in the proximal potion of the fallopian tube
Answer: peg cells
Flashcard 9: Plasma cells have abundant RER and a well-developed _____ (yellow arrows)
Answer: Golgi apparatus
Flashcard 10: The histopathological image represents the _____ gland, which is a type of holocrine gland.
Answer: sebaceous
